The rise of the playful cursors

The traditional cursor serves a single purpose; Get where you want to go in the blink of an eye with a simple click. For years, it remained an element that was not taken into account in websites because changing it seemed unnecessary for all those who provide web design services, since it does not fulfill any aesthetic function.
But the times are changing. Now, more and more websites opt for interesting and interactive designs, which has also opened a new path for the cursors.
More than anything, the aesthetics of the cursor is changing rapidly and most of the time it is synchronized with the style of the web in question. For example, if it is a site about photography, your web design agency can convert the cursor to the center point of a camera, so you can use it to capture the "images" of different parts of the site you want to access.
This means that the days of just pointing and clicking were gone. These days, you can even click and hold certain items to get a video to play or a GIF to load on modern websites.
In fact, you can see different functions depending on whether you hold down or click with the mouse, which gives your web development partner more space to play with interactive parts.

Shocking in black and white with a cherry on the top

Colors are something that can change the way people see your website. That's why choosing the right tones for your site is one of the most important things to consider.
People associate different moods with different colors and designers have taken advantage of this since the early days of the Internet. Although getting rid of most colors does not seem like an effective idea, designers are becoming creative with the two simplest colors: black and white.
The two colors have always been an interesting pair of art. One reflects openness and light, while the other is the absolute opposite, it makes you feel imprisoned. Modern websites are taking advantage of these colors because they feel more professional and also allow designers to show their skills.
Lately, this trend has increased, but this time your digital marketing agency could use them with a minimum of other colors to highlight something important. For example, a soft shade of red behind an element protrudes like a cherry on top.
The most important thing is that the use of black and white with other colors allows you to capture the attention of your users the way you want, maintaining the aesthetic.

Helvetica to master logo designs

With websites increasingly vibrant and intriguing over time, the same cannot be said for website logos. The common logo now receives a new facelift.
Last year, we witnessed an increase in the brands of playful words to represent the eccentric side of brands. But this time, they are looking to achieve the minimalist look of sans-serifs or similar styles. In short, all the popular brands you see now get a Helvetica version of their logo.
While some brands may benefit from this simple approach, others may not be as appreciated. Because this type of cold design starts to bother some people.
This could be a symbol of maturity and growth, but the lack of eccentricity will certainly eliminate the warmth of certain logos.
